我想在VB.NET中编写一个小应用程序,以检测婴儿的哭声。我将如何开始使用这样的应用程序?

最佳答案

我的想法:如果您可以访问原始麦克风数据:


对设置值求平均值,并去除标准偏差以外的所有噪声(这将消除大多数背景噪声)
标准化数据集
专注于较高的色调
配置软件以在频率范围内的大声声下注册事件


取决于要为此付出的努力:可以使用贝叶斯或神经网络来确定声音是否是婴儿。这会使程序变得更加复杂,但是当婴儿不希望出现这种情况时,它将尝试抚慰婴儿。

07-27 13:38